1. Own Your Actions
In a world where blame is tossed around like confetti, achievers don’t play the victim. They live by the motto “If it’s to be, it’s up to me.” Pointing fingers means handing over your power. Other people’s opinions don’t define you. You can’t control everything, but your thoughts and actions are yours to steer.
2. Live with Purpose
What sets high achievers apart is living life intentionally. Having a purpose is key to being fully alive. It’s not about scraping by; it’s about doing the job right. Find a cause, build a business around it, and let your commitment shine.
3. Plan it Out
Goals without a plan are like wandering through unfamiliar roads hoping to reach a city. You’ll waste time and energy, likely giving up. Unwritten goals are mere fantasies. With a written plan, you’ll reach your destination faster.
4. Pay the Price
Dreaming big is common, but success comes to those who know the cost and pay it. Complaining won’t get you there. No reputation or experience? Make those calls. Pay the price for your dreams.
5. Become an Expert
Motivated folks crave excellence. Would you be proud of a how-to tape of your work? If not, aim to be the best in your field. Study the experts and emulate their success.
6. Never Quit
When your goal is non-negotiable, quitting isn’t an option. Stay focused or tweak your goals. Perseverance is your ally in reaching dreams. Ask yourself, “Is this getting me closer?” If not, pivot.
7. Don’t Wait
Time is limited. High achievers grasp this reality. They pursue goals with energy and passion, not dwelling on the ‘forever.’ Act now – go after your dreams with gusto.
